Peter Schmeichel is a famous goalkeeper who played for the English football club Manchester United. He also played for the Danish national team. Winner of a huge number of trophies, including the Champions Cup with Manchester United and the European Champion title with the national team.

Biography

The "Great Dane" was born in the tiny Danish commune of Gladsaxe. His father was Polish and his mother was Danish. From birth in November 1963 until the age of seven, Peter had Polish citizenship. Despite all his great achievements in sports, Peter did not have much love for football as a child. He liked making music, playing the piano more, and football was more of a hobby. During his school years, the future goalkeeper was in a rock group that he created with his classmates.

Career

The famous Schmeichel started at home, in the Gladsaxe club of the same name. In it, he made his debut for the senior team in 1981. After playing there for two years, he moved to another Danish club, Vidorve, where he also spent two seasons. The talented footballer was already watched by the scouts of local top clubs, and in 1987 he received an offer from one of these. Without hesitation, he signed a contract and started playing for Brøndby. At the beginning of his career, Schmeichel played in different positions and even tried himself as a striker. This experience became very useful for him. Schmeichel is one of the few versatile goalkeepers to be called the 11th outfield. He played equally well in the goal frame and on the way out.

And such versatile players have always been highly regarded by the legendary manager of Manchester United Sir Alex Ferguson. Having learned from the scouts about the rising Danish star, he could not ignore it. In 1991 the talented goalkeeper was transferred from Brøndby to Manchester United. English club mentor Sir Alex later dubbed the move the "deal of the century." Schmeichel from the very first season became the main goalkeeper of the club and defended the last line of Manchester United until his departure from the club in 1999.

Image
Image

For all the time in the legendary club, Schmeichel played 398 matches, and even scored in one of them. This happened in 1995 as part of the Champions Cup. Manchester United played with the Russian club Rotor and at the end of the meeting Schmeichel scored a goal after a corner kick. Despite being defeated on aggregate, the talented goalkeeper's goal is considered one of the best goals in Manchester United history.

Schmeichel participated in one of the most famous Champions League finals in 1999 and has made an invaluable contribution to the team's success. Manchester United, losing 0-1 during the meeting, managed to snatch victory at the very end of the meeting. In one of the episodes, a goal from a corner was scored thanks to the actions of Schmeichel in the opponent's penalty area.

Personal life

Peter Schmeichel is not married. For a long time he was married to the daughter of his first football mentor, Berta. But since 2013, they have been officially divorced. Peter has a son, Kasper, and, like his father, plays football as a goalkeeper. In favor of the English club Leicester. Since 2013, he has been defending the last frontier of the Danish national team.
